Hi Carolina. I haven't come across this one before!! Usual cause for an unplanned shutdown is overheating but it wouldn't normally restart by itself. However worth checking there is no dust in the fan outlet. If your battery is removable shut down the laptop, disconnect the power lead (if connected), remove the battery and then press the power button for a couple of seconds. Then put it together again and see if that has made any difference.
